Man who drove his van into crowd at LGBTQ event shot dead by police in Berlin
A man suspected of driving a minivan into a crowd near Berlin’s Pride festival that killed at least one person and injured 29 others was shot dead by police after a 24-hour manhunt. The suspect, 21-year-old Abdul Ballout, had previously sought to join Islamic State, AP reported. Police said he "ran towards them with...bladed weapon", prompting officers to open fire.
